Have you heard that linen fabric shrinks and are you a little apprehensive about using it for your sewing projects? You shouldn’t be. Yes, linen shrinks but there are things you can do to minimize the shrinkage and transform a basic fabric into a fabulous garment or accessory. Pure linen is made from the fibres of the flax plant, a versatile plant in the universe. Pure linen has a history of more than 30000 years. Historically, Egyptians recognized its value and grown flax to make textiles and clothing. Interestingly, linen was used as a currency in Egypt which shows its high value at the time.
